What is Pokemon Dark Worship 2?
Pokemon Dark Worship 2 is the follow-up to the popular FireRed hack Pokemon Dark Worship, now rebuilt and expanded in the Sinnoh region with fresh surprises and an original, custom storyline. The game picks up after events from the classic Sinnoh titles — Pokemon Diamond, Pearl, and Platinum — but forges its own path with new conflicts, new faces, and new mysteries that ripple through the region.
After Cyrus’s disappearance into the Distortion World, Sinnoh was quiet for a time — but not for long. The remaining operatives of Team Galactic have allied with the shadowy Team Dark Worship under the leadership of Joshua, the son of Izac. Together they plot something that could reshape the destiny of Sinnoh’s legendaries. The full scope of their plan is still unknown, and the player will unravel it piece by piece.
The game blends classic Sinnoh charm and beloved characters (Barry, Dawn, Professor Rowan, and more) with the original cast from the Dark Worship universe, giving long-time fans and newcomers alike a familiar yet unpredictable experience. With Pokemon from Generations 1 through 9, expanded encounters on every route, and a custom quest-driven narrative, Pokemon Dark Worship 2 aims to deliver a deep, replayable RPG experience that honors the originals while adding plenty of new thrills.

Prologue — The Disappearance of Cyrus
Years ago, in Sinnoh, Cyrus — the enigmatic commander of Team Galactic — was defeated by the hero of Sinnoh and cast into the Distortion World by Giratina. Team Galactic dissolved on the surface, but its ideology did not die. Small cells and loyalists lingered in the shadows, biding their time.
In the years since, rumors spread of strange distortions and sightings around Sinnoh’s ancient sites. Scholars debated whether the Distortion World had truly been sealed or if remnants of its chaos still reached into our world. Meanwhile a new power rose: Team Dark Worship, a cult-like organization with its own dark aims and rituals. Its leader, Joshua — son of Izac — has been quietly amassing influence and resources.
What changed everything was an unprecedented alliance: surviving officers of Team Galactic joined forces with Team Dark Worship. The two groups began working in concert, pooling knowledge of the legendaries and the Distortion World. Their combined reach now threatens to awaken forces best left sleeping — Dialga, Palkia, Giratina, even Zygarde. The very fabric of time, space, and balance in Sinnoh could be at stake.

Game Features
1. Sinnoh Region & Custom Storyline
Set after the events of the core Sinnoh titles, the game reimagines the region with a brand-new narrative. You’ll meet familiar faces (Professor Rowan, Barry, Dawn, Sinnoh gym leaders) alongside characters from Pokemon Dark Worship: the protagonist, your rival, members of Team Dark Worship, and more. This crossover creates an epic saga full of new events and unexpected twists.
2. Pokemon from Gen 1 to 9
Catch and battle with Pokemon spanning Generations 1 through 9. Route encounters have been reworked, and trainers may use Pokemon from any generation — meaning every battle can feel fresh and unpredictable.
3. All 27 Gen 1–9 Starters
Choose your starter from a complete roster of 27 starters (one from each relevant starter family across the generations). Which one will you pick from this massive lineup?
4. Characters from Sinnoh & the Seafood Region
This game is a crossover between the Sinnoh universe and the Seafood Region (the world of Pokemon Dark Worship). Expect a blend of personalities: Professor Rowan, Barry, Dawn, Sinnoh’s gym leaders, alongside the Dark Worship protagonist, rival, Team Dark Worship members, and other unique characters.
5. Following Pokemon
Following Pokemon is one of the most beloved features in ROM hacks, and this game includes a carefully crafted following system that brings your companion Pokemon to life beside you on the overworld.
6. Exp Share All & EXP on Catching
The game features a full Exp Share All system to help your entire party level together — a modern convenience that saves time and eases grinding. Additionally, you earn EXP when you catch a Pokemon, a feature that rewards exploration and collection in a way the originals did not.
7. Two Villain Teams Unite
The villains are now joined: Sinnoh’s Team Galactic (led by surviving officers such as Saturn) has tied up with Team Dark Worship (led by Joshua). Their combined schemes threaten the balance of Sinnoh. How will you stop them?
8. Three Difficulty Options
Choose the difficulty that fits your playstyle:
- Normal Mode — A balanced, classic experience. Trainers and wild Pokemon follow standard levels for a fair adventure with the classic Sinnoh feel.
- Hard Mode — Battles are significantly tougher. AI is more aggressive; additional restrictions apply to increase challenge:
- You may only use up to four items per battle at maximum difficulty.
- A Level Cap becomes mandatory, limiting the maximum level Pokemon can reach at each stage.
- The Level Cap prevents overleveling and keeps encounters competitive.
- Expert Mode — The ultimate challenge. Battles are brutal: AI is maximized and many conveniences are disabled to preserve balance and tension:
- The exchange/trading of items during battle will be disabled.
- Buffing and weather-altering abilities may be restricted.
- Moves that raise stats or inflict certain status-altering effects can be banned in battles.
- A strict Level Cap will be enforced throughout the game to maintain difficulty and prevent overpowering.
Expect a demanding, tightly balanced experience for veterans seeking extreme challenge.
9. Character Mugshots
The game features high-quality character mugshots for many NPCs and major characters. These portraits enhance interactions and make conversations feel immediate and alive.
10. Mid-Battle Evolutions
This new mechanic allows your Pokemon to evolve during a battle the moment they reach their evolution level. Traditional games wait until the fight ends, but here evolution happens instantly, adding excitement and making certain battles feel completely unpredictable.
11. New UI Overhaul
The game features major visual improvements across the entire interface. The Pokemon summary screen, item bag, battle layout, trainer card, and several menu designs have been fully updated with cleaner layouts and improved colors, giving the adventure a more polished and modern aesthetic.
12. Infinite TM Use / Deletable HMs
TMs can now be used as many times as you want, letting you teach moves without any limitation. HMs can also be deleted at any time without visiting a Move Deleter, allowing much more freedom when customizing your Pokemon’s moves.
13. Z-Moves
The popular battle mechanic from the Alola region returns. With the right Z-Crystal, your Pokemon can unleash a powerful Z-Move once per battle, giving you an additional strategic option during tougher encounters.
14. New Items Replacing Many HMs
Some exploration abilities no longer rely on using HMs directly. Instead, new convenience items activate automatically when needed. For example, the item “Crazy Maze” works as an alternative to Rock Smash—simply interact with a rock and the game will break it for you. HMs still exist, but these new items help make exploration smoother and less restrictive.

Game Progress
The current release of the game as on December 07, 2025 is just a beta/demo version which just showcases the game and its early gameplay. For now the game only goes upto the first gym battle.
